This week we’re continuing our Enneagram in Relationships series with a look at Type Four — The Romantic or The Individualist
If you’re a Four or if you love someone who is, this type is emotionally attuned, introspective, and expressive. They often feel different than others, they notice what is beautiful, what’s broken, and what is uniquely theirs.
In this week’s episode we learn more about Type Four’s, how they navigate relationships and I share a few practical ways to better communicate with, support, and lead a Type Four.
Whether you love, work with, or lead a Type Four you will appreciate the depth, vulnerability, and meaning they bring to relationships. They value real connection, meaningful conversation, and space to be fully themselves.
